WebAll that you need to remember is that 1 Watt of energy is equivalent to 3.41 BTU’s. Alternatively, if you have a BTU measurement and would like to find out the heat output of your radiator in Watts all you would need to do is divide the BTU’s by 3.41. What size radiator do I need? Officially, 1 BTU is equal to the amount of energy it takes to increase the heat of 1 pound (0.45 kg) of water by 1 degree Fahrenheit. In actual, rather than theoretical measurements, 1 BTU=1055 joules. Any radiator will come with a BTU output.

Room greater than 18 feet (5.5 m) (six meters) long on any side are tough to heat. Larger rooms benefit when you make space for two or more radiators.
